This is the mail archive of the binutils@sourceware.org mailing list for the binutils project.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

[PATCH, MIPS] Add -march=xlp


Hi,

This patch adds basic support for Broadcom XLP (formerly NetLogic/RMI XLP) to Binutils.  There is a patch authored by NetLogic that also includes definitions for XLP-specific instructions, but it is not clear when that will be posted.  For now, my goal is to enable GCC to be able to compile with -march=xlp and this patch accomplishes that.  None of the new XLP instructions are not generated by GCC.

Hopefully, Broadcom / NetLogic will post their full patch some time soon, but, meanwhile, is this OK to check in?

Tested by building a mips64-linux-gnu toolchain with -march=xlp (with a corresponding GCC patch).

Thank you,

--
Maxim Kuvyrkov
CodeSourcery / Mentor Graphics


Attachment: binutils-basic-xlp.ChangeLog
Description: Binary data

Attachment: binutils-basic-xlp.patch
Description: Binary data


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]